First thing that I will comment on is that your About page appears to have the file name of www.casa-maripos.html

Yo should change that as it makes the web address of that page http://www.casa-mariposa.com/www.casa-maripos.html

It really should be something like (for Max SEO Juice) about-casa-mariposa.html

As far as the experience on iPad goes it isn’t bad at all.

But for best results on all devices you should move up to FW7’s responsive features and make more use of undefined heights on text boxes etc.

Also set your viewport width to device width (in the Inspector).

Did I say that I hate Splash Pages - they do nothing for your SEO, especially when they contain no meaningful content and in your case no actual text.
